Other Events. - --------------------- On June 11, 1999, Base Ten Systems, Inc. (the "Company"), Ex-BTS Clinical, Inc., a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company ("BTSC"), Almedica International Inc. ("Almedica") and Almedica Technology Group Inc., a wholly-owned subsidiary of Almedica ("ATG") entered into an Agreement and Plan of Merger (the "Agreement"). Pursuant to the Agreement, the Company acquired ATG by the merger of BTSC with and into ATG (the "Merger") and ATG changed its name to BTS Clinical, Inc. In the Merger, the Company issued 3,950,000 shares of its Class A Common Stock to Almedica, which shares have not been registered under the Securities Act of 1933, as amended. The Company and Almedica entered into a Registration Rights Agreement pursuant to which the Company would register the shares issued to Almedica in the Merger in certain circumstances. Clark L. Bullock, chairman of Almedica and former chairman of ATG, became a director of Base Ten upon consummation of the Merger. The Company entered into an Employment Agreement and a Change in Control Agreement with Robert J. Bronstein, former president of ATG. Mr. Bronstein will serve as president of the Base Ten Applications Software Division. In connection with the Merger, the Company and Almedica entered into a Program License Agreement pursuant to which the Company licensed certain software to Almedica. Almedica agreed not to compete, directly or indirectly, in North America in the business conducted by ATG at the time of the Merger until the fifth anniversary of the Agreement. The Company and Almedica each agreed to indemnify the other party for the breach of certain representations, warranties, covenants, agreements or obligations made by such party in the Agreement.
